Patton College of Education offers inside look at master’s programs, certificate offerings

The Patton College of Education will offer informational sessions Nov. 17 to 20 about available online master’s programs and certificate offerings, as well as an overview of using OHIO educational benefits for Patton College programs.

  • Tuesday, Nov. 17 from 6 to 7 p.m.: The Advanced Online Master’s Degree Programs – Curriculum and Instruction and Reading Education. Click here to register.
  • Wednesday, Nov. 18 from 6 to 7 p.m.: The Online Special Education Programs – master’s degrees and STEM+ for ALL. Click here to register.
  • Thursday, Nov. 19 from 5:30 to 6:30 p.m.: Education Public Policy Leadership Certificate. Click here to register.
  • Friday, Nov. 20 from noon-1 p.m.: How to Use Your OHIO Educational Benefit for Patton College Programs. Click here for more information.

Attendees will learn about the program’s requirements, deadlines, and application process. OHIO employees will also learn how they can apply their educational benefits to the program. For more information, contact Tasha Attaway at attaway@ohio.edu.
